How to prepare for a job interview at Maldron Hotel Finsbury Park

Know Your Ingredients

Familiarise yourself with the key ingredients and techniques relevant to the role of a Junior Chef de Partie. Be prepared to discuss your favourite dishes and how you would approach creating them, as this shows your passion and knowledge in the kitchen.

Showcase Your Team Spirit

Since the role involves working closely with senior team members, highlight your ability to collaborate and learn from others. Share examples of how you've worked in a team before, especially in high-pressure situations, to demonstrate your readiness for the kitchen environment.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the Dalata Academy programmes and how they can help you grow. This not only shows your interest in the position but also your eagerness to develop your skills and take advantage of internal opportunities.
